CIAT is closely following the progress of the Building Safety Bill which is now back in the Commons for consideration of amendments on 20 April, before moving to Royal Assent.

Members and affiliates might be interested to note that many of the factsheets have been updated in anticipation of the new legislation and these can be accessed here.

The link provides a series of factsheets which offers more information about the provisions in the Building Safety Bill and how they will be implemented (see list and direct links below).

We would also suggest that you visit Health and Safety Executive: factsheets as these give details about the Health and Safety Executive's early position on the regulatory approach of the Building Safety Regulator.
